The Timeless Beauty of Copper

One of the primary reasons why many homeowners opt for a copper roof over their bay window is its timeless beauty. Copper has been used in architecture for centuries, and its rich, warm hue adds a touch of elegance to any home. As the copper ages, it develops a natural patina that further enhances its aesthetic appeal, making it a perfect choice for homeowners who appreciate the charm of age-old materials.

Durability and Longevity

In addition to its visual appeal, copper roofs are known for their exceptional durability and longevity. Unlike other roofing materials that may require frequent repairs or replacements, copper roofs can withstand the test of time and harsh weather conditions. They are highly resistant to corrosion, fire, and extreme temperature changes, making them an ideal choice for homeowners looking for a long-term roofing solution.

Low Maintenance

Maintaining a copper roof over your bay window is relatively easy and hassle-free. Unlike other roofing materials that may require frequent cleaning or repairs, copper roofs are virtually maintenance-free. They do not rust, corrode, or require painting, saving you time and money in the long run. Occasional cleaning with mild soap and water is sufficient to maintain the roof’s appearance and ensure its longevity.

Installation Process

Installing a copper roof over a bay window requires the expertise of a professional roofing contractor. They will carefully measure your bay window’s dimensions and design a custom roof that perfectly fits your home’s architecture. The installation process involves shaping the copper sheets to match the bay window’s contours, ensuring a seamless and watertight fit. The contractor will also apply soldering techniques to join the sheets, creating a durable and aesthetically pleasing roof.

Cost Considerations

While a copper roof over a bay window offers numerous benefits, it is essential to consider the cost implications. Copper is a premium roofing material, and its installation costs can be higher compared to other options. However, the long-term durability, low maintenance, and timeless beauty of copper make it a worthwhile investment that adds value to your home.
